Title: Fish Go Deep, feat. Tracy Kelliher @ IMPRINT, Belfast Nov 27
Date Added: 17 Nov 2004

No Image

SOMETHING FISHY….

preview by Graham Crothers (Alternative Ulster) November 2003

Saturday 27th November is a date worth looking forward to when deep house dons Fish Go Deep appear at Imprint, Basement Bar, Belfast, for the launch of their upcoming album ‘Lil’ Hand’- and its an NI exclusive date t‘boot!

Fish Go Deep are Greg Dowling and Shane Johnson. They have recently begun a new residency at Fast Eddies in quality clubbing music mecca Cork. The club night ‘Go Deep’ recently relocated after a year of madness which included pretty special names like Needs and Charles Webster to pick out just a few. Spinning since the late 80’s their residency at Ireland’s longest running and best known house club, Sweat at Sir Henry’s in Cork, spanned more than a decade and influenced a generation of Irish clubbers and deejays, not to mention that they brought over outright heavyweights in the form of Joe Clausell, Derrick Carter, Kerri Chandler and Herbert. Their production work meanwhile has been released on such labels as Brique Rogue and Chez Music.

On the night they will assisted by Tracey Kelliher on vocal duties, who appears on a number of tracks off the forthcoming album. A regular on the Irish DJ circuit, Tracey has played high profile gigs at dance music festivals down south such as Cork Jazz and Heineken Groove Weekenders. She also supported hip hop legends The Roots on their only Irish concert as well as Groove Armada back in 1999 at the Cork Opera House. If the show is even half as good as it was the last time they played Belfast then we’re in store for a stonking night.

The album is expected by the end of the year. Be on the lookout.
